In account-driven User Enrollment, service discovery plays a crucial role by helping to identify the Mobile Device Management (MDM) enrollment URL automatically. When a user wants to enroll their device, the system utilizes the service discovery mechanism to find the appropriate MDM server that will manage the device. This approach streamlines the enrollment process, making it user-friendly and efficient, as users do not need to manually input the MDM URL.

The importance of service discovery in this context is that it allows for a smoother integration of personal and work-related data on the device. The MDM can dynamically guide users to the relevant resources and settings, ensuring that the user experience remains seamless while the organization maintains control over the management of the device.
